Rock Wool Insulation Batt

A pre-cut batt made from spun rock wool fibers, bonded with resin, used for thermal and acoustic insulation in walls and attics. It falls under HTS 6806.90.00.90 as a heat-insulating and sound-absorbing article of mineral material, not classified in headings 6811, 6812, or chapter 69.

Alternative Classifications

This product could be classified differently depending on its characteristics or intended use.

6806.20.00Same rate: 35%

If loose, unbonded mineral wool fibers without shaping

Loose fibers like rock wool roving classify under the specific subheading for mineral wools, not articles.

6811.82.00Same rate: 35%

If containing over 30% asbestos fibers

Asbestos-cement articles or mixtures shift to Chapter 68 heading 6811 due to hazardous composition exclusion.

6902.10.10Same rate: 35%

If fired and shaped into refractory bricks

Heat-processed mineral materials become ceramic refractory products under Chapter 69.

Import Tips & Compliance

Verify R-value certification and fiber composition to confirm classification under mineral wools, avoiding misclassification as plastic foams

Include safety data sheets (SDS) for respirable fibers in documentation to meet EPA and OSHA import requirements

Ensure packaging labels indicate non-combustible properties to prevent reclassification as building materials under Chapter 68

Related Products under HTS 6806.90.00.90

Exfoliated Vermiculite Loose Fill

Expanded vermiculite granules used as lightweight loose-fill insulation for attics and masonry walls, providing fire resistance and thermal protection. Classified under HTS 6806.90.00.90 as an expanded mineral material for heat-insulating purposes, distinct from mixtures or shaped articles.

Mineral Wool Acoustic Ceiling Tile

Perforated ceiling panels made from compressed slag wool with a decorative facing, designed for sound absorption in commercial spaces. It qualifies for HTS 6806.90.00.90 as a sound-absorbing article of mineral materials, excluding those of heading 6811 or 6812.

Foamed Slag Thermal Block

Lightweight blocks produced from expanded foamed slag, used for insulated concrete forms in construction. Falls under HTS 6806.90.00.90 as an expanded mineral material article for heat-insulation, not refractory products of chapter 69.

Expanded Clay Pebbles Hydroponics

Round, lightweight expanded clay aggregate (LECA) balls used as growing medium in hydroponic systems for thermal insulation and drainage. Classified in HTS 6806.90.00.90 as expanded clays, a sound-insulating mineral material not covered by other headings.

Slag Wool Pipe Insulation

Cylindrical jackets of resin-bonded slag wool for insulating steam pipes and HVAC ducts, reducing heat loss and noise. HTS 6806.90.00.90 covers this as a heat- and sound-insulating article of mineral wool.

Vermiculite Fireproof Board

Compressed exfoliated vermiculite boards for fire-rated enclosures and safes, offering high-temperature insulation. Under HTS 6806.90.00.90 as a mixture/article of heat-insulating mineral materials.
